About the role

Frontend TypeScript Developer (AI Training)

What if your TypeScript expertise could directly shape how AI writes code for millions of developers around the world? We're looking for experienced TypeScript developers to review, evaluate, and guide AI-generated frontend code — ensuring it meets the standards of type safety, scalability, and modern architecture that real-world applications demand.

This is a fully remote, flexible contract role built for senior developers who know TypeScript inside and out. You'll work alongside leading AI research teams, using your technical judgment to make AI smarter, more accurate, and genuinely useful for the developer community.

About The Role

  • Organization: Alignerr
  • Type: Hourly Contract
  • Location: Remote
  • Commitment: 10–40 hours/week

What You'll Do

  • Review AI-generated TypeScript code for strict type safety, accurate interface design, and correct use of generics and utility types
  • Develop complex, type-safe frontend components that deepen AI understanding of modern web architectures
  • Provide clear, detailed technical commentary on architectural decisions and type-driven development strategies
  • Identify and flag weaknesses in AI responses related to complex type definitions, asynchronous patterns, and frontend edge cases
  • Work independently and asynchronously — fully on your own schedule

Who You Are

  • Deep expertise in TypeScript — you're fluent in static typing, generics, interfaces, and utility types
  • 3–5 years of hands-on experience with modern frontend or full-stack frameworks such as React, Angular, Next.js, Nuxt.js, or Node.js
  • Strong written communicator who can explain technical decisions clearly and concisely
  • Detail-oriented and methodical — you notice when something is subtly wrong and you know why
  • Bachelor's degree or higher in Computer Science or a related field preferred
